柑橘种间体细胞杂种的核质遗传研究

摘    要:为了解柑橘体细胞杂种的核质遗传组成,采用流式细胞仪(FCM)、简单序列重复(SSR)、相关序列扩增多态性(SRAP)以及酶切扩增多态性序列(CAPS)对此前通过对称融合获得的2株种间体细胞杂种进行了分析。结果表明,在丹西红橘+红江橙种间组合中,分析的2株植株中1株为二倍体非对称体细胞杂种,其核DNA具有双亲的部分DNA,并有重组发生,胞质DNA则来源于红江橙(叶肉亲本);而另1株则是异源四倍体体细胞杂种,其核DNA来源于双亲,并有重组发生,胞质DNA则来源于红江橙。

Inheritance of nuclear and cytoplasmic components of inter-specific somatic hybrids in Citrus

Abstract:FCM,SSR,SRAP and CAPS were employed to characterize the nuclear and cytoplasmic components of two inter-specific somatic hybrid plants obtained by symmetric fusion.The results showed that in Dancy tangerine(Citrus reticulata)+ sweet orange(C.sinensis Osbeck cv.Hongjiangcheng) inter-specific combination,one of two analyzed plants was diploid asymmetric somatic hybrid,which inherited nuclear DNA from some of both parents and cytoplasmic composition from sweet orange(leaf parent);the another one was tetraploid...
